Grace Margaret Chapman, 89, of Ivanhoe, Texas, passed away on December 28th, 2025, surrounded by her family. Grace was born June 9th, 1936, in Port O'Connor, Texas, the daughter of Joe Chano and Amelia 'Gonzales' Chano. Her childhood years were spent on the Texas coast prior to moving to San Antonio as a teenager.
She met the love of her life, Kenneth Dale Chapman, during his first year of service stationed at Lackland Air Force Base on a blind date. They married on September 2nd, 1956, at the Chano family home in San Antonio, TX., and were married for 68 years.
Grace spent the bulk of her years as a faithful military wife – helping in every move to make each house a home, whether it was near an airbase in Alaska, Wisconsin, Texas, and Lake Charles, Louisiana where they settled while their children; Kenny, Randy and Beverly attended school. Later in life, Ken & Grace moved to Ivanhoe, Texas, where their family home has held countless memories for nearly 30 years.
Grace adored her husband Ken, along with her children, sisters, grandchildren, and great-grandchildren. Her legacy is marked by a deep love for her family and friends, spending time on numerous dance floors with Ken, and cooking for the people she loved. She was a sports fan through and through, but a piece of her heart will always belong to the Dallas Mavericks (specifically, Dirk Nowitzki).
